Remove Ads

World's Largest Praying Hands Trip

  • 2
  • 01:30
  • 96 mi
  • $16
Take This Trip

Created by LeticiaCampos - August 13th 2015

10801 N I 35 Service Rd, Oklahoma City, Oklahoma

95mi 01h 30m